Requirements
  • A Bachelor of Science degree in Engineering, Engineering Technology including Manufacturing Technology, Computer Science, Data Science, Mathematics, Physics, Chemistry, or a directly related non-U.S. equivalent qualification.
  • At least 5 years of related work experience or an equivalent combination of education and experience for Level 3.
  • At least 3 years of experience in cloud security architecture and design, focused on major cloud platforms such as Amazon Web Services, Azure, or Google Cloud Platform.
  • The applicant must meet U.S. export control compliance requirements as a U.S. Person, defined to include a U.S. citizen, U.S. national, lawful permanent resident, refugee, or asylee.
Responsibilities
  • Develop, implement, and sustain product security and resiliency throughout the requirements, design, build, test, production, operations, and support lifecycle.
  • Develop and enhance system requirements and architectures for product security to meet applicable certification and customer requirements.
  • Ensure the security of facilities, equipment, tools, data, networks, and resources used for product design, development, build, test, storage, delivery, operations, and support.
  • Define and identify product security requirements for suppliers of components and subsystems for integration into Boeing products and services.
  • Coordinate with governments, customers, suppliers, and industry to identify risks and improve industry and regulatory security standards and requirements for programs and interfacing systems.
  • Conduct research and development activities resulting in innovative solutions.
  • Advise customers on maintaining product security and certification, including security consequences of modifying products and services.
  • Lead or oversee the development, implementation, and sustainment of product security and resiliency, system security requirements and architectures, supplier security requirements, coordination with external stakeholders, research and development, and customer advisement according to the assigned level.
  • Consult with enterprise senior leadership on complex product security technical recommendations, solutions, risks, and opportunities at Level 5.
Desired Qualifications
  • At least 9 years of related work experience for Level 4.
  • At least 14 years of related work experience for Level 5.
  • Experience in Public Key Infrastructure operations, identification, report creation, and custom scripting.
  • Experience writing and implementing Infrastructure as Code with Bicep, Azure Resource Manager, or Terraform.
  • Experience in cybersecurity solutions architecture focused on cloud technologies, DevSecOps, and secure system design.
  • Experience in vulnerability management, risk assessment, or security analytics.
  • Experience working in a software Scaled Agile environment.
  • Experience with the Risk Management Framework or DFARS NIST 800-171 compliance.

Boeing designs, builds, and sells commercial airplanes, defense systems, and space technology. Its products include airliners such as the 737, 747, 767, 777, and 787, as well as military aircraft like the F-15, F/A-18, and AH-64 Apache, along with space projects tied to the International Space Station and Artemis. The company also offers maintenance, upgrades, cybersecurity, and autonomous systems to support customers worldwide. Boeing differentiates itself with large-scale, end-to-end aerospace capabilities and a diversified portfolio across commercial, defense, and space, serving a global customer base with a goal of providing safe, reliable air and space technologies while growing through ongoing capabilities and services.

Boeing appoints new controller amid 34% overvaluation claims and MAX 7 certification

Boeing has appointed Ryan L. Shedd as Senior Vice President and Controller, effective after the upcoming 2026 Form 10-K filing. The aerospace manufacturer's shares currently trade at $214.20 amid mixed investor sentiment. The company's operating recovery shows progress but remains incomplete. Commercial Airplanes narrowed its operating margin from negative 5.1% to negative 2.7% on 171 deliveries versus 150 previously. Boeing is ramping 737 production to 47 aircraft monthly from 38 a year ago, targeting 52 next year. The FAA certified the MAX 7 today after nearly a decade. Valuation assessments diverge sharply. One analysis suggests Boeing is 33.9% overvalued at the current price, implying fair value of $160.01. However, a discounted cash flow model indicates shares trade 45.4% below an estimated value of $392.50.

Boeing Q2 revenue up 8% to $24.56B, beats estimates as aerospace stocks show strong quarter

Boeing reported Q2 revenues of $24.56 billion, up 8% year on year and exceeding analyst expectations by 1.7%. However, the aerospace manufacturer missed earnings per share estimates despite the revenue beat. Chief executive officer Kelly Ortberg said the company is making progress executing its plan, with more stable operations and certification programmes remaining on track. Boeing's focus has been on restoring trust through sustained emphasis on safety, quality, and on-time performance. The stock has risen 7.2% since the earnings announcement and currently trades at $226.65. Boeing's results came as part of a strong Q2 for aerospace stocks, which collectively beat revenue estimates by 1.7% and provided next quarter guidance 5.5% above expectations.

Boeing shares up 7.4% YTD as defence wins and record $597B backlog fuel turnaround hopes

Boeing shares have gained 7.4% year to date, matching the Zacks Aerospace-Defense industry's growth. The company's commercial aviation segment delivered 171 airplanes in Q2 2026, up 14% year over year and the highest quarterly total since 2018. Segment revenues rose 8% to $11.75 billion. Boeing secured 246 net commercial orders during the quarter and ended with a record $597 billion backlog. The 737 programme began transitioning production to 47 airplanes per month. In defence, the US Navy MQ-25A Stingray and Air Force T-7A Red Hawk both achieved Milestone C, clearing them for low-rate initial production. Boeing also signed agreements with Polish entities to support maintenance of Poland's AH-64E Apache helicopter fleet.

Archer Aviation acquires three Boeing businesses for 19.75% stake in exchange

Archer Aviation has agreed to acquire three Boeing businesses — Wisk Aero, Insitu, and SkyGrid — in exchange for newly issued Archer stock. When the deal closes, Boeing will receive a 19.75% stake in Archer's Class A shares. The acquisition significantly bolsters Archer's defense business. Insitu, a military-drone company, generates over $200 million in annual revenue, compared to Archer's $300,000 in 2025. Wisk has completed more than 1,700 eVTOL flight tests, whilst SkyGrid provides air traffic management. The deal diversifies Archer beyond its urban air taxi ambitions, though it comes at the cost of shareholder dilution. Boeing also holds two warrants that could cause further dilution. Archer's shares initially surged 25% on the news before settling to a 13% gain.
